A lorry has ploughed into the railway bridge at Ickleford forcing the closure of both approaches.
Paramedics are at the scene assessing the male driver, who is out of the vehicle, while officers have shut Arlesey Road either side of the bridge.
The road is a popular rat run between Letchworth GC and Hitchin.
The lorry, which hit the bridge shortly before 1.45pm, cannot be removed until an engineer from Network Rail has assessed the damage to the structure, a police spokesman said.
